The balance in Common Shares on January 1,2020 , and December 31,2020 , is respectively $145,000 and $172,500. During the year, a $57,000 repurchase of shares was recorded(i.e. shares were bought back). During the year, shares were also issued. The proceeds from the issuance of shares that would appear in the financing activities section on the cash flow is: $29,500$64,500$84,500$260,500 Question 6 (1 point) Retained Earnings had a balance on January 1, 2020, and December 31, 2020, respectively, of $234,500 and $411,000. Net income for the year was $199,500 and the only other event affecting Retained Earnings was the declaration and payment of dividends. The payments for dividends that would be reported on the financing section of the cash flow is: $23,000 $176,500 $376,000 $0
